A Limited Vision

1/14/2013

 
Now unto him that is able to do exceeding abundantly above all that we ask or think, according to the power that worketh in us.  Ephesians 3:20

We’ve all experienced what we have believed God for not coming to pass in our lives.  When this happens, it can be confusing, frustrating, and even disappointing.  Why does this occur?  Sometimes it is not the result of sin in our life.  A vision that is too small is one reason why the thing you have believed God for might not have come to pass.  Perhaps you have been believing God for a boyfriend or girlfriend and He wants to give you a husband or wife, you may have been believing God to be a manager and He wants to make you the company CEO, or perhaps you have been believing God to simply pay your bills but He wants to give you enough money to not only pay your bills, but someone else’s as well.  God is unlimited and there is nothing too hard for Him (Genesis 18:14).  Even if you do dream a big dream, He is able to even exceed that dream according to Ephesians 3:20.  Psalms 78:41 actually states that people can limit God.  How do we limit Him?  We limit Him by not believing that He can do what we desire or by not having a big enough vision.  Dare to embrace an enormous vision and watch God bring it to pass in your life!
